Manitoba Hydro is seeking an experienced Technology Security Analyst.

Under the general guidance of the Chief Information Security Officer, the Technology Security Analyst is responsible for assisting the Chief Information Security Officer maintain the integrity, confidentiality, and availability of corporate information, networks, applications and other technology assets. The analyst will design, implement, monitor, and enforce overall technology security policies, processes, and guidelines for the Manitoba Hydro technology environment that are driven by technology directions, strategic initiatives, user requirements, corporate risk expectations, and administrative minimization.

The analyst provides guidance and consulting assistance to management, staff, and project teams by recommending and enforcing security controls for new and existing technologies and applications within the corporate technology environment. The analyst is also responsible for developing, presenting and managing the dissemination of information security procedures and training materials to all users within Manitoba Hydro’s technology environment.

Responsibilities:
-Provide recommendations for Technology Security planning and direction.
-Provide Technology Security consulting services to the IT Services Division and the Corporation, including EMS/SCADA systems support, to ensure consistency of security practices across all systems and networks.
-Support the development, implementation, communication, monitoring and maintenance of the Technology Security policies, standards, and procedures.
-Provide Technology Security Incident Management (manages the reporting, investigation and resolution of data security incidents).
-Conduct Technology Security assessments of systems, applications and networks.
-Ensure Disaster Recovery Plans and practices are in accordance with security guidelines.
-Provide Technology Security awareness programs and develop new initiatives.
-Provide assistance with Technology Security threat intelligence, SIEM management and Technology Security architecture.
-Maintain contact with industry security standards setting groups, and an awareness of legislation and regulations pertaining to information security.
-Provide support to all Technology Security compliance requirements.
-Conduct Technology Security research and keep current on all Technology Security-related issues.
